Course Details
• Facebook Ad Manager Basics: Understanding the interface, setting up ad accounts, and creating campaigns.
• Facebook Audience Targeting: Researching and selecting audiences for ad placements.
• Facebook Ad Formats: Exploring different ad formats, such as image, video, and carousel ads.
• Budgeting and Scheduling: Setting up daily and lifetime budgets, and scheduling ads.
• Performance Metrics: Tracking and analyzing ad performance with metrics such as CPC, CPM, and CTR.
• Bidding Strategies: Overview of Facebook's bidding options, including lowest cost, target cost, and bid caps.
• Manual Bidding: Setting up manual bids and adjusting bids based on performance data.
• Automated Bidding: Using Facebook's automated bidding strategies, such as lowest cost with bid cap.
• Optimization for Ad Delivery: Understanding and using Facebook's ad delivery optimization options.
• Ad Placement and Frequency: Choosing the right ad placements and managing ad frequency to maximize ROAS.
